How does it notify you exactly?
When a notification comes in, there is a small vibration and both hands point to a number, 1-12, for a few seconds. (4? maybe?)
You can set all these in the app, so I reserved 1-5 for calls/texts from specific individuals, 6 is google hangouts/FB Messenger, 9 is social media notifications, 11 is Gmail and 12 is Calendar.
It's a pretty slick way to have a "smartwatch" that isn't just another smaller phone on my wrist, and I'm not doing the "my phone buzzed in my pocket, better pull it out to check, oh it's not something I care about but let's scroll through instagram while we're here."
That is really clever, as long as you can remember which setting = which. Knowing me I would probably forget
I think if you approach it in a nonrandom way, it's ok. If it's on the right side of the face, I know it's a real live person trying to contact me right now. If it's on the left side, it's a Computer trying to get my attention.
